Nohilly's Blood from a Stone — about a troubled working-class family — will kick off the season Dec. 13 at the Acorn Theatre at Theatre Row. The starry cast will include Ethan Hawke, Natasha Lyonne, Daphne Rubin-Vega, Becky Ann Baker, Thomas Guiry and Gordon Clapp. Scott Elliott, artistic director of the New Group, will helm the production. Performances are scheduled to continue through Feb. 19, 2011. The season will continue March 3 with a revival of Shawn's marital strife play Marie and Bruce. The 1979 work will co-star Academy Award winner Marisa Tomei and Frank Whaley. Artistic director Elliott will also direct this production, which will run through April 23, 2011. Additional casting will be announced at a later date.
The New Group season will conclude with Kaufman's One-Arm, which is based on an unproduced Tennessee Williams screenplay and classic short story. The staging is a co-production with Kaufman's Tectonic Theatre Company. Kaufman will also direct the play, which is scheduled for a May 5-June 25 run. Casting is to be announced.
